So, how about slightly goodwill to ourselves? It’s not that i am speaking about self-indulgence and self-obsession, however self-compassion. It doesn’t imply deciding that you’re at all times nice and not flawed. It way accepting that you’re human and that, like everybody, you do your perfect however from time to time make errors. Fresh analysis displays that self-compassion is very important for our psychological well being and, as I give an explanation for in my new e book The Keys to Kindness, it’s a ways from egocentric as a result of it may well go away you in a greater place to be type to others.

Scientists have more than a few strategies of measuring self-criticism and self-compassion, however maximum revolve round self-report scales. For example, imagine the next statements. Do any of them ring true for you?

“I concern that if I transform kinder to and no more important of myself my requirements will drop.”

“Getting on in lifestyles is ready being difficult moderately than compassionate.”

“When I attempt to really feel type and heat to myself I simply really feel roughly empty.”
